This morning was truly freezing cold on Gavà beach, with the cars frozen and the fields near the sea completely frozen. A postcard of very vivid cold, without a doubt, that we can see in The Photos of the Readers of La Vanguardia.

The Baix Llobregat Agricultural Park is not only an ideal space for walking between the large cities of the Barcelona area, but it is also one of the oldest and most fertile agricultural areas.

Gavà, located between the Garraf massif and the Llobregat Delta, has a municipal area of ​​30.76 square kilometers, where it still preserves cultivated fields between the urban core and the beach area.

The four kilometers of maritime coastline and its approximately 3,500 hours of sunshine a year are one of its main tourist attractions, but that does not prevent frosts from occurring right next to the sea when the cold weather arrives.

Frost is a meteorological phenomenon that consists of a drop in ambient temperature to levels below the freezing point of water and causes the water or vapor in the air to freeze, depositing it in the form of ice on surfaces, such as It can be seen in the car glass.
